Output dfdbe01223b68e33ab2016a427ed138aff7b6f0ccda296f64d43343e0ad51cec:0

value
2323500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95af9a2045e987b348bbf672cc6608963bece9cd OP_EQUAL
address
3FLUyAt3aYicJAk3AuqgAeHkvNTTthevPx
transaction
dfdbe01223b68e33ab2016a427ed138aff7b6f0ccda296f64d43343e0ad51cec
spent
true